생활
엑셀 날짜별 데이터에서 이번주 값만 더하는 함수
아래 예시 그림처럼 구글 시트에 정리된 일별 작업량 데이터가 있습니다.
여기서 개개인의 이번주 목표량 달성률을 체크할 수 있도록, 이번주 작업량의 합계를 구하고 싶은데 어떤 수식을 써야할지 모르겠습니다.
각 이름 위에 작업자별 달성률을 띄워서 작업자들에게 매일 '금주의 작업량 달성 현황'을 상단에 띄워서 확인할 수 있도록 하는 게 목표입니다.
처음에는 아래와 같이 써봤는데 값이 0으로 나옵니다.
=SUMIF($B$3:$B$93,WEEKNUM($A$3:$A$93)=WEEKNUM(TODAY(),2))
55글자 더 채워주세요.
1개의 답변이 있어요!
안녕하세요 소중한후루티9입니다.
SUMIF 함수는 특정 조건에 맞는 범위의 값을 합산할 때 사용되지만, 복잡한 조건을 처리하기엔 한계가 있습니다. 여기서는 WEEKNUM 함수와 SUMIF를 바로 결합하기보다는, SUMPRODUCT 함수처럼 논리 연산을 포함한 합산이 더 적합할 수 있습니다.
=SUMPRODUCT(($B$3:$B$93)*(WEEKNUM($A$3:$A$93,2)=WEEKNUM(TODAY(),2)))
이번 주 작업량을 합산하고 각 작업자의 달성률을 계산하는 수식을 제안합니다.